| 1. | Click the Lower limbs toggle to display the corresponding page. |

| 2. | In the Lower limbs positioning part of the window, select the left or right leg angle to adjust: |
| 3. | The part of the leg that will move is highlighted in red. |
| 4. | Use the mouse to move the leg: |
| 5. | Click |
| 6. | In the graphic window, pick a node on the leg (the available nodes are displayed in green) and move the mouse to rotate the leg. The leg is moved along a red circle. |
| 7. | When finished, click Yes in the Dialog menu bar. |
| • | If necessary, pick another node to move the leg around the same angle, or click Cancel in the Dialog menu bar. |
